[PATCH 12/12] perf tools: Try to build Documentation when installing

From: Arnaldo Carvalho de Melo
Date: Wed Oct 24 2012 - 17:52:28 EST


From: Borislav Petkov <borislav.petkov@xxxxxxx>

There's a portion in the "perf list" output refering to the exact
specification of raw hardware events.

Since this description is in the perf-list manpage, try to build and
install the man pages, warning the user when that is not possible
due to missing packages (xmlto and asciidoc).
